Transaction 56ef3eb91f060dfbbbdd291c7f3d246899268384537df5cacea35429cd75e971

1 Input
2 Outputs
  • 56ef3eb91f060dfbbbdd291c7f3d246899268384537df5cacea35429cd75e971:0
  • value  20732
    address  12MC8LovwMAnzvWYFUaAmDQyVCrBmetAHa
  • 56ef3eb91f060dfbbbdd291c7f3d246899268384537df5cacea35429cd75e971:1
  • value  2761105
    address  1AfEXgmcWReAkoxQ8csGSCtPsxPhJPBcsf